Understanding Estate Planning Essentials
Numerous people may neglect the value of estate planning, understanding its essentials is essential for making certain that one's assets are dispersed according to individual desires after fatality. Estate Planning involves the procedure of managing an individual and arranging's properties and liabilities while taking into consideration future circumstances. Fundamental components consist of wills, counts on, and powers of attorney, each offering unique functions. A will certainly details exactly how assets ought to be dispersed, while counts on can give even more nuanced control over property administration. In addition, a power of lawyer marks somebody to make clinical or monetary decisions on part of a private if they end up being incapacitated. Comprehending the nuances of these documents and their effects is essential for anybody looking for to secure their tradition. Estate Planning additionally includes factors to consider relating to taxes, financial debts, and potential guardianship for dependents, making a detailed technique important for reliable management of one's estate.

Usual Mistakes to Prevent in Estate Preparation
Lots of people unknowingly commit significant errors throughout the estate Planning process that can make complex or threaten their intentions. One common mistake is failing to update their estate intends frequently, especially after significant life events such as marriage, divorce, or the birth of a child. An additional constant oversight is neglecting to communicate their wishes to household members, which can lead to complication and problem amongst beneficiaries. Additionally, several individuals take too lightly the relevance of picking ideal recipients, potentially causing unintended distributions of assets. Some might also overlook tax ramifications, which can diminish the value of an estate. Inevitably, attempting do it yourself estate Planning without expert assistance typically leads to invalid documents or lawful loopholes. Avoiding these challenges needs careful factor to consider and, ideally, cooperation with an experienced lawyer who can assist guarantee that the estate strategy aligns with the person's desires and sticks to legal needs.

Advantages of Trusts
Trusts use several advantages that improve estate Planning beyond what wills can give. One substantial benefit is the ability to bypass probate, permitting for quicker distribution of properties to recipients. This can preserve and reduce costs personal privacy, as trust fund papers normally do not become public document. Counts on also provide better control over asset distribution, allowing people to specify problems for inheritance, such as age demands or landmarks. Additionally, depends on can shield assets from lenders and supply assistance for small children or individuals with specials needs, guaranteeing their recurring treatment. Generally, utilizing count on estate Planning can create an extra flexible, efficient, and protected technique to handling one's heritage, making them an important tool together with wills.

What Occurs if I Pass Away Without an Estate Strategy?
If someone dies without an estate strategy, their assets are distributed according to state legislations. This often brings about hold-ups, prospective disagreements among successors, and unexpected beneficiaries receiving parts of the estate

Can I Change My Estate Strategy After It's Developed?
Yes, an individual can alter their estate plan after it has actually been created. Alterations can be made to reflect life modifications, such as marital relationship, divorce, or the birth of a child, making certain the strategy remains appropriate.
Exactly how Frequently Should I Review My Estate Plan?
People must examine their estate prepares every 3 to 5 years or after significant life occasions, such as marital relationship, divorce, or the birth of a child, to guarantee it precisely reflects their present desires and scenarios.
